Iowa HF2254 mandates the University of Iowa Hospitals and Clinics to prohibit noncompete clauses in employment contracts for physicians. The bill directs the board of regents to develop a policy that prevents the inclusion of such clauses in contracts entered into, extended, or renewed after the bill's effective date. The prohibition applies to all contracts involving physicians, defined as individuals licensed under chapter 148. The bill takes effect upon enactment.
